Detailed Description
The technical solution is further explained by referring to the drawings in the above specification, and the specific description is as follows:
referring to fig. 1 to 5, a shunt valve of a water leakage discharging structure includes a water inlet body 1 and a water outlet body 2 connected with the water inlet body through a screw, a water inlet 3 is fixed on the top of the water inlet body, a plurality of water outlets 4 are fixed on the side of the water outlet body, wherein the plurality of water outlets are respectively a toilet-washing water outlet, a toilet-washing water outlet and a self-cleaning water outlet, and a cleaning liquid inlet 5 is fixed on the top of the water outlet body. And in order to facilitate positioning and installation, the C-shaped installation support lug 7 is integrally formed on the outer wall of the water inlet main body.
A reversing stepping motor 8 is fixed on the side of the water inlet main body through a screw, in the embodiment, a control circuit board is arranged on the top of the reversing stepping motor, a rotating shaft 9 is arranged in a valve cavity formed by the water inlet main body and the water outlet main body, the rotating shaft is fixedly connected with a main shaft of the reversing stepping motor, a water diversion sheet 10 is connected to the rotating shaft, a water guide channel 11 is fixed on the water diversion sheet, and a water diversion valve spring 12 is arranged between the side surface of the water diversion sheet and the inner wall of the rotating shaft;
a Y-shaped sealing ring mounting groove 13 is formed in the joint of the rotating shaft and the water inlet main body, a Y-shaped sealing ring body 14 is arranged in the Y-shaped sealing ring mounting groove, the fork end of the Y-shaped sealing ring body is located on the inner side, a water drain hole 15 extending to the Y-shaped sealing ring mounting groove is formed in the inner wall of the water inlet main body, and the water outlet end of the water drain hole is located below the reversing progress motor. In this embodiment, it is provided with the Y shape sealing washer body to the jag end of Y shape sealing washer body is in the inboard, and it has certain shock-absorbing capacity, cooperation axis of rotation, and overall structure durable is difficult to wearing and tearing, thereby is favorable to improving life.
In the practical application process, a convex ring 16 is arranged on the inner wall of the water inlet main body, a circular ring 17 is integrally formed on the side wall of the rotating shaft, when the rotating shaft is connected with the water inlet main body, the outer side face of the circular ring is attached to the inner wall of the water inlet main body, a Y-shaped sealing ring installation groove is formed between the convex ring and the circular ring, the Y-shaped sealing ring body is located in the Y-shaped sealing ring installation groove, the fork opening position of the Y-shaped sealing ring body is pressed on the circular ring face, the vertical part of the Y-shaped sealing ring body is pressed on the inner side face of the convex ring, and the water discharge hole is located on the bottom wall of the convex ring. Its installation through the axis of rotation in the use, forms Y shape sealing washer mounting groove through the combination of bulge loop cooperation ring, is favorable to the installation to be used, and its vertical portion supports to press on the bulge loop simultaneously, also can improve sealed reliability, guarantees the stationarity and the reliability of installation.
The axis of rotation 9 includes the axle arch 91 at center, and the lateral surface integrated into one piece of axle arch has spacing ring 92, be provided with the clearance 93 that shifts between spacing ring and the axle arch, the shunt valve spring is in the outside of spacing ring, the side of water diversion piece be provided with shift clearance matched with bellying 18, the water diversion piece is in on the axle arch and the bellying is in shift in the clearance. In this embodiment, adopt above-mentioned structure, can adjust the position of water diversion piece on the axoplasm as required to satisfy the user demand of different situation, wherein the length of bellying is less than the degree of depth in clearance that shifts moreover, thereby can cooperate with the play water main part of difference and realize dividing the water operation, improve its application scope.
